The cheapest one will be Blitz for about $250 +paint job, or you can go with chrome Junction produce grill for $500.

Another option will be Grazio&Co, but I think it is more like a refinished stock grill (pretty much the same with what Lee has done to his grill) and it will cost you about $320 (with emblem base tad) to $380 (without emblem base tab)+international shipping from Japan.
